Transaction 5fc21b2aedbc39fdb7c55cb6ebc3cd552ff07a3d5ff6028fe491ac94bffb771c
1 Input
2 Outputs
- 5fc21b2aedbc39fdb7c55cb6ebc3cd552ff07a3d5ff6028fe491ac94bffb771c:0
- 5fc21b2aedbc39fdb7c55cb6ebc3cd552ff07a3d5ff6028fe491ac94bffb771c:1
value 51796862
address 12Qy2HVkZLweMAQ6aN11NRTrosDQDdJrov
value 22881189
address 14hir1BVkbkbGaaZyManQyaaasW15utvHv